About this position
The Department of Physics at the University of Jyväskylä is recruiting a Postdoctoral Researcher in Doppler and Sympathetic Cooling of Radioactive Ions for the newly funded DopCool project, supported by the Research Council of Finland. The position is hosted at the IGISOL facility within the Accelerator Laboratory in Jyväskylä, Finland, and sits at the intersection of atomic, nuclear and particle physics, laser spectroscopy, ion trapping and ultra-high-precision mass spectrometry.
The project aims to pioneer laser-based cooling techniques for short-lived radioactive ions and to establish a new experimental route for precision mass measurements. The successful candidate will help develop and operate laser systems, optimize a laser-cooling trap built with partners at KU Leuven, integrate the trap with the JYFLTRAP Penning trap mass spectrometer, and perform the first Doppler and sympathetic cooling measurements of stable and radioactive ions. The role also includes simulation work, beam-manipulation device design, experimental participation at IGISOL, and publication and conference presentation of results.
This is a fixed-term postdoctoral appointment starting in November 2026 or as soon as possible thereafter, initially for 1 year with the possibility of extension by up to 2 additional years. The salary is approximately €3700–€4200 per month gross, depending on qualifications and experience, and a holiday bonus is included. The University offers support for relocation and promotes good working conditions, equality, diversity and international research collaboration.
Applicants must have completed their PhD before the start date. Required experience includes experimental atomic, nuclear or particle physics, laser systems, vacuum technology, electronics, data acquisition, scientific programming (e.g. Python), and data analysis. Experience with Doppler/sympathetic cooling, ion trapping, mass spectrometry, laser spectroscopy, and radioactive ion beam production (IGISOL or ISOL) is considered advantageous. Good written and spoken English, strong motivation, and problem-solving ability are essential.
Apply via the University of Jyväskylä recruitment system by 25 September 2026. The application must be submitted in English and include an ORCID profile, CV, motivation letter, publication list, degree certificate, and two reference letters sent directly to the listed contact email.
